asked the Minister for Lands if he will state in respect of Laoighis and Offaly (a) the localities in which 1,302 acres of land were divided during the year 1948-49; and (b) the townlands for which schemes for acquisition and division are being prepared, with the names of the estates concerned.
Written Answers. - Division of Leix and Offaly Lands.
Mr. Boland
(a) The localities are:—
OFFALY.—Clonbrin near Rathdangan; Clonmel and Clonbrown near Clonbullogue; and Coolacrease near Cadamstown.
LEIX.—Cromoge and Cashel near Portlaoighise; Derrinduff near Mountrath; Derrin near Borris.
It would be contrary to the public interest to furnish the information sought in part (b) of the question.
